[lojban] Re: My parser and ZOI



--- Robin Lee Powell <rlpowell@digitalkingdom.org> wrote:
> 
> What this does is replace[1] the zoi boundary word (i.e. gy in "zoi gy
> whee! gy") with the string QZOIMARKER.  That string was chosen to be
> descriptive.  The Q is there to make sure it's not valid Lojban, so that
> the pre-processor's efforts can never be mis-construed as valid for some
> reason other than processing ZOI correctly.

Could there be a problem if the string QZOIMARKER appears within the
quoted text? Something like zoi gy .... QZOIMARKER ... gy? Probably
not very frequent, except maybe when discussing you parser in Lojban.
